It’s also vital to be familiar with the difference between uncommon earth minerals and unusual earth metals. "Minerals" seek advice from the Uncooked rocks—like bastnasite, monazite, xenotime, or ionic clays—that contain rare earths in all-natural kind. These call for intensive processing to isolate the metallic aspects. The expression “metals,” On the flip side, refers back to the purified chemical aspects Utilized in substantial-tech programs.
Processing these minerals into usable metals is expensive. Outside of China, few nations around the world have mastered the entire industrial course of action at scale, while spots like Australia, the U.S., Vietnam, and Brazil are Doing work to change that.
Demand from customers is currently being fuelled by numerous sectors:
· Electric mobility: magnets in motors
· Renewable Electrical power: specially wind turbines
· Buyer electronics: smartphones, laptops, sensors
· Defence: radar, sonar, precision-guided systems
· Automation and robotics: significantly critical in industry
Neodymium stands out as a particularly valuable unusual earth because of its use in highly effective magnets. Many others, like dysprosium and terbium, boost thermal steadiness in higher-general performance programs.
